What is the degree of x4 – 3x + 2?

Mathematics
1 answer:
mihalych1998 [28]3 years ago
4 0

Answer: 4

Step-by-step explanation:

The degree is the highest exponent , in which in this problem it is 4. The 3x counts as an exponent of 1 because the variable x is 1, and the 2 counts as an exponent of zero. Which means the degree is 4.

Yair is buying a dog carrier for his puppy. The carrier is 20 inches long, 13 inches wide, and 16 inches high. What is the volum
scZoUnD [109]

Answer:

4160 cubic inches

Step-by-step explanation:

The dog carrier is in the shape of a rectangular prism (cuboid).

The volume of a rectangular prism is given as:

V = L * W * H

where L = length, W = width, H = height

The carrier is 20 inches long, 13 inches wide, and 16 inches high.

Therefore, its volume is:

V = 20 * 13 * 16\\V = 4160 in^3

The volume of the dog carrier is 4160 cubic inches.
